首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将通讯簿联系人图像加载到集合视图单元格

是一个常见的需求,可以通过以下步骤来实现:

  1. 获取通讯簿联系人数据:使用适当的API或库,如iOS的Contacts框架或Android的ContactsContract,从设备的通讯簿中获取联系人数据。
  2. 加载图像数据:从联系人数据中获取图像数据,并将其加载到内存中。这可以通过使用适当的图像处理库,如SDWebImage(iOS)或Glide(Android),来实现。
  3. 创建集合视图:使用适当的UI组件,如UICollectionView(iOS)或RecyclerView(Android),创建集合视图来展示联系人图像。
  4. 设置集合视图单元格:在集合视图的单元格中,将加载的联系人图像设置为单元格的图像视图的内容。这可以通过设置图像视图的图像属性来实现。
  5. 显示集合视图:将集合视图添加到适当的视图层次结构中,并在界面上显示出来。

通过以上步骤,你可以将通讯簿联系人图像加载到集合视图单元格中。这样,用户就可以通过滚动集合视图来查看并与联系人的图像进行交互。

在腾讯云的生态系统中,可以使用腾讯云的一些相关产品来支持这个功能:

  1. 图像处理:腾讯云的云图像处理(Image Processing)服务可以帮助你对图像进行处理和转换,如缩放、裁剪、旋转等操作。你可以使用该服务来优化和处理联系人图像。
  2. 对象存储:腾讯云的对象存储服务(COS)可以用来存储和管理联系人图像数据。你可以将联系人图像上传到COS,并在需要时从COS中获取图像数据。
  3. 移动推送:腾讯云的移动推送服务(Push Notification)可以用来向移动设备发送通知消息,如联系人更新或新联系人添加的通知。你可以使用该服务来提醒用户有新的联系人图像可用。

请注意,以上提到的腾讯云产品仅作为示例,你可以根据具体需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券